Located in the iconic Coca-Cola plant on Route 28 in Salem, NH, Par28 is the area’s newest hotspot that comfortably blends a lively bar and open-concept kitchen with high-end golf simulation and challenging axe-throwing bays. The walls were removed to provide the open space needed for the intricate layout. Golf and axe bays have particular dimension requirements, especially with height, so a major portion of the design process focused on fit and layout. Much attention was given to the bar design to serve the most amount of patrons. Even more, Par28’s signature coal-fired pizza oven needed to be featured and viewable from multiple angles. Their distinctive shark tank required a showcasing area, and the six 75-inch TVs necessitated proper placement above the bar. Adding in the axe and golf areas, programming demanded extra consideration for power sources, exterior exhaust, plumbing, and patron flow - all while making sure spaces were safe for patrons. The challenge to accommodate areas for large group gaming and smaller intimate social spaces was achieved.
